Introduction

The choice of topic is integral to the success in EE. It is important for students to choose a subject and topic they are passionate about so that they stay motivated throughout the EE process. As subject availability for the EE is not the same for each session, the EE Coordinator will provide a list of DP subjects on offer.

After choosing the subject for the EE, the next step in the process is to define what their research is going to focus on. Students need to choose a topic and undertake some background reading in it.

Questions to consider

  • Which subject area is of most personal interest to you?
  • Is there something you are especially curious about in one of your IB courses?
  • Did your personal project spark an idea that can be researched?
  • What are my possible topics?
  • What do I know about those topics?
  • Which words would be good search terms and keywords?
